
Thiruvilwamala (Thrissur): A giant tapioca was harvested from a single flowerbed here. The tapioca weighing 63-kilograms grew in the farm of Pambady native Sibichan George.
He had harvested tapioca weighing 43 kilogram and 56 kilograms in the previous years. This time, the tapioca weighing 63 kilogram, 54 kilogram and 30 kilogram were harvested from the farm.
Sibichan planted an indigenous variety of tapioca called ‘Kulavan’ brought from Mannarkkad. He had planted 400 plants as intercrop to give shade to the areca nut saplings in the farm.
Sibichan harvested 20 kilograms of tapioca from each flowerbed during the season. He said that he sold the tapioca for Rs 85,000.
